    Robyn, you are awesome! A little hint with using Wonder Under-I saw that your iron stuck to the material. The glue will also get on the ironing board cover. I make a paper sandwich. I put a scrap piece of paper down first on the ironing board then the piece you are cutting out, then another piece of scrap paper. I ruined my ironing board cover with all the glue from Wonder Under. Not too mention the glue on the iron. Hope this helps!
